When new Scratchers join the Scratch website, they often have questions...
What is Scratch, and what can I do with it?
How do I get started Scratching?
How can I meet other Scratchers on the website?
The Welcoming Committee can help answer these questions by welcoming New Scratchers through projects in the Welcoming Committee studio.
How can I become a member of the Welcoming Committee?
Any Scratcher can join the Welcoming Committee!
First create a project to welcome new Scratchers. It should...
- Be friendly, welcoming, and enthusiastic.
- Describe something that you like about Scratch.
- Invite New Scratchers to comment on the project to introduce themselves and ask questions.
- Include a brief introduction to Scratch.
- Link to the Scratch Wiki and another helpful place.
- Look appealing and include a backdrop or a couple of sprites.
Then submit your project by leaving a comment with a link on the Welcoming Committee studio. (See this project to learn how to post a link). A Welcoming Committee coordinator will view your project and give suggestions for changes until it's ready for the studio. Once your project is accepted, you’re a member of the Scratch Welcoming Committee!
How will I help New Scratchers?
When someone new registers for Scratch, they'll see a link to a random Welcoming Committee project on their My Stuff page. You can help by...
- Replying to their comments on your project
- Answering their questions
- Encouraging them as they begin Scratching
To find out more about how to help, please read this guide: https://scratch.mit.edu/projects/48863130/
What if I want to opt out?
If you wish to opt out of the Welcoming Committee, tell a Welcoming Committee coordinator or comment on the studio, and they'll remove your project from the studio.
